Body & Dimensions
The Lincoln Aviator is a 7-seater SUV with a length of 4909 mm, width of 1877 mm, and height of 1800 mm. It has a wheelbase of 2889 mm and a front track of 1547 mm. The rear track is 1554 mm, providing a stable ride.

Fuel Consumption
The Lincoln Aviator is a petrol (gasoline) powered vehicle with a fuel consumption of 18.1 l/100 km in the city and 13.1 l/100 km on the highway, which is equivalent to 13 US mpg in the city and 17.96 US mpg on the highway.

Weight & Capacity
The Aviator has a weight-to-power ratio of 7.6 kg/Hp (132.2 Hp/tonne) and a weight-to-torque ratio of 5.7 kg/Nm (175.4 Nm/tonne). It has a kerb weight of 2315 kg (5103.7 lbs.) and a maximum weight of 2850 kg (6283.17 lbs.), with a maximum load capacity of 535 kg (1179.47 lbs.). The trunk boot space ranges from 351 l (12.4 cu. ft.) to 2189 l (77.3 cu. ft.), and it has a fuel tank capacity of 85 l (22.45 US gal | 18.7 UK gal).
